Would You Drink Cocktails Made Of Meat?

meat-cocktails-big
We're not sure if we qualify as sadomasochists, but we certainly like to gross ourselves out when it comes to food. After giving up Happy Meals and Chicken McNuggets for good, we've already vowed not to eat, err sip, the latest entry into the meat market, drinks made with processed meat. Introduced by Flor de Caña in NYC recently, these alcoholic beverages are billed as "savory carnivorous cocktails that invoke meat lovers favorite meals." There's recipes for drinks called the "Cheeseburger" (beef, iceberg lettuce, dry mustard powder), the "BLT" (bacon-infused rum, worcestershire sauce), and the "PB & J," which doesn't contain dead animals, just egg whites. FYI, we're making barf noises right now. For full recipes, check out Gothamist—just don't invite us over for a martini.
